Andrew Christopher Brees ( born January 15, 1979 in Austin, Texas) is an American professional American football player at the position of quarterback. He plays for the New Orleans Saints in the National Football League ( NFL).

New Orleans Saints

Brees had to be with the Saints in 2006 by then successful year. With 4,418 yards space thanks to his passes, he led the league. He was also at the end of the season third with 26 touchdown passes and a passer rating of 96.2. In 2008, Brees improved several personal records. With 5,069 yards space gain from his passports he missed the NFL record set by Dan Marino only 15 yards. He also threw 34 touchdowns with 17 interceptions and came again to a rating of 96.2. He was elected as the FedEx Air Player of the Year 2008.

After the 2009 season, Brees led the Saints to the first Super Bowl participation of team history. The game, Super Bowl XLIV, in Miami won the Saints with 31:17 against the Indianapolis Colts. Brees was named Super Bowl MVP for this. The magazine Sports Illustrated later elected him Sportsman of the Year in 2010, as the Associated Press.

On December 26, 2011, he broke in the 15th game of the regular season ( in game week 16 of 17) held by Dan Marino since 1984 record for yards thrown in a single season. Brees scored a total of 5,476 yards in the 2011 season. Moreover, he was so among other things to the AP Offensive Player of the Year selected.

On 13 July 2012, Brees and the Saints agreed to a new contract until 2017, at least 60 million U.S. dollars, in the best case brings even 100 million U.S. dollars to the quarterback. That made Brees the highest-paid football player in the history of the NFL.
